### Protecting Yourself from Online Hoaxes: A Call for Critical Thinking

To protect yourself from falling prey to online hoaxes, it’s crucial to practice critical thinking. Always verify information from multiple reliable sources, including established news organizations and official statements. Be wary of sensational headlines and emotionally charged language, which are often used to spread misinformation. If something seems too good (or too bad) to be true, it probably is. Furthermore, be mindful of the sources you follow online and critically evaluate the information they share.
